Non-Destructive Evaluation, Sr Engineer - Materials & Process Engineering
Bring your experience and ideas to provide specialized support across all phases of rotorcraft design, development, testing, and sustainment for both Commerical and Military programs. As part of the team, you will contribute to Bell's success by driving advancements in NDE-related process specifications, developing and implement inspection procedures, and creating innovative inspection methods. Your work will play a vital role in ensuring Bell delivers a high-performing, durable, and safe aircraft to its customers.
What you'll be doing as a Non-Destructive Evaluation M&P Engr
- Coordinate, develop, and validate NDE inspection methods and techniques
- Perform NDE related audits and assessments
- Create and modify NDE related specifications
- Innovate and develop new and improved inspection methods
- Represent Bell at industry committee meetings and conferences
- Provide NDE solutions during all phases of the aircraft program lifecycle
Skills You Bring To this Role
- Experience with Ultrasonic Inspection and other NDE methods (Eddy-current Testing (ET) , Penetrant Inspection (PT), and Radiography (RT))
- Knowledge regarding aerospace specifications and quality requirements
- NDE automation and application skills to effectively meet inspection requirements
- Ability to effectively communicate and collaborate with internal and external stakeholders
- We are looking for inquisitive and driven engineers with a passion to innovate.
What you need to be successful
- Minimum 2 years of experience in the field of Non-Destructive Evaluation
- Bachelor's degree in Engineering or other technical discipline required. Related degrees with relevant experience will be considered.
- Ability to thrive in a team environment
